Serena Williams to take on Madison Keys in Italian Open final

By Ians English

Rome, May 15: Serena Williams advanced on Saturday to the Italian Open final with a 6-4, 6-1 win over Romania's Irina-Camelia Begu and will try to clinch her first title of the season when she squares off against Madison Keys in an all-American final on Sunday.

The world No. 1 and top seed, who lost the Australian Open and Indian Wells finals to Germany's Angelique Kerber and Belarusian Victoria Azarenka, respectively, needed just 1 hour and 27 minutes to eliminate Begu, according to EFE news agency.

In Saturday's first semifinal, third-seeded Spaniard GarbiÑe Muguruza fell against unseeded American world No. 24 Madison Keys 7-6 (7-5), 6-4 and thus missed out on a chance to reach her first final of the season.

Keys, who had never advanced past the second round in Rome, also will be vying for her first title of the season on Sunday.
